About
Begun by the Crusaders in 1115 and dedicated to Saint John-Marc, patron of Byblos, this Romanesque cathedral blends Frankish and local Levantine stonework. Damaged repeatedly by earthquakes and conflict and restored by the Maronite Order in the 1770s, it remains an active church with a serene open-air baptistery beside it. It sits a short walk from the souk and the castle.
